5.0 out of 5 stars An excellent manual for teachers, October 13, 1998
By A Customer
First of all, it should be pointed out that this excellent manual adhers to the principles of the Royal Ballet School in London. Many different aspects are being dealt with, for instance "The importance of stance", "Comments on the teaching of boys", "Physical factors". One very useful chapter is called "The development of children with youthful skeletal age". This book is aimed at teachers of beginners and intermediate students and they ought to study it carefully. It is very amply illustrated, the photographs are posed for by children of the appropriate age. One of the final chapters "The build-up of a class" in which each step is painstakingly explained, should be read, re-read and then read again by the teacher in order to convey the idea of perfect execution to the pupil.

3.0 out of 5 stars Good Refresher, May 17, 2004

I enjoyed this book, but I also thought that this was review for the experienced actor. Though it does have some new ideas, anyone who has had experince in movement or advanced acting will understand and recognize these techniques. I think it's hard to write an acting text without sounding a bit superior. She kept referring to her schooling as "drama school". I think it's good for people to read as a refresher course
